[commands] Properly raise the correct exception for owner_ids
Also some minor nits with documentation.

diff --git a/discord/ext/commands/bot.py b/discord/ext/commands/bot.py
index 8924ba57..9cdef77b 100644
--- a/discord/ext/commands/bot.py
+++ b/discord/ext/commands/bot.py
@@ -111,13 +111,10 @@ class BotBase(GroupMixin):
self.owner_ids = options.get('owner_ids', {})
if self.owner_id and self.owner_ids:
- raise ValueError('Both owner_id and owner_ids are set.')
- elif not isinstance(self.owner_id, int):
- raise ValueError('owner_id is not an int.')
- elif not isinstance(self.owner_ids, (set, list, tuple)):
- raise ValueError('owner_ids is not a set, list or tuple.')
- elif not all(isinstance(i, int) for i in self.owner_ids):
- raise ValueError('owner_ids has to be an iterable of int.')
+ raise TypeError('Both owner_id and owner_ids are set.')
+
+ if self.owner_ids and not isinstance(self.owner_ids, collections.abc.Collection):
+ raise TypeError('owner_ids must be a collection not {0.__class__!r}'.format(self.owner_ids))
if options.pop('self_bot', False):
self._skip_check = lambda x, y: x != y
